Data Snapshot: ZIP 96055 (Los Molinos, CA)

For 2022, the average cost of homeowners insurance in ZIP 96055 (Los Molinos, CA) runs $1,398 per year, based on U.S. Treasury FIO's ZIP-level tracking across approximately 24 reported policies. Against a national average of $1,776 per year, ZIP 96055 comes in 21% below, the 39th percentile among all tracked ZIPs. California homeowners pay $1,864 per year on average; this ZIP diverges by 25% (below), ranking #953 of 1545 tracked ZIPs in California by premium. The closest-priced peer within California is Torrance (ZIP 90505) at $1,397, essentially matching this ZIP's rate.

The loss ratio for ZIP 96055 is 28.2%, meaning insurers retained a working margin after claims. Claim frequency, the share of policies with at least one claim, is 2.74%, and the average claim severity (amount paid per claim) is $14,392. Insurers decline to renew 1.44% of policies in ZIP 96055 at expiration, a rise of 302.7% over the past five years; a rising rate typically signals carriers retreating from higher-risk markets.

Premium data spanning 5 years shows ZIP 96055 costs have risen 33.3% since 2018, from a low of $1,049 to a high of $1,398, an annualized rate of +7.5% per year.

How to read these numbers

The figures on this page come from the U.S. Treasury Federal Insurance Office, which collects homeowners insurance premium and claims data directly from the largest property insurers in the country. Because the data is aggregated at the ZIP-code level and averaged across many policies, it describes the typical cost in an area rather than a quote for any single home. Two houses on the same street can pay very different premiums depending on their age, construction type, roof condition, prior claims, and the specific coverage limits and deductibles the homeowner selects. The loss ratio shows how much of every premium dollar insurers paid back out as claims; a ratio above one means carriers lost money locally, which often precedes rate increases or carrier exits. Rising nonrenewal and claim frequency reveal how stressed the local market has become. Use these figures to gauge the direction and scale of costs in your area, then request quotes from several licensed carriers before buying or renewing a policy. FIO data aggregates voluntary reporting from the 40 largest homeowners insurers, covering roughly 80% of the U.S. market, so figures represent market averages rather than individual policy quotes; your own premium will vary with dwelling value, deductible, coverage limits, construction type, and insurer-specific underwriting.
